Union Berlin’s Mauro Lustrinelli Confirms Christopher Trimmel as Captain
In a recent interview with Sport Bild, Mauro Lustrinelli, the new head coach of Union Berlin, has officially confirmed that Christopher Trimmel will continue to serve as the team’s captain. The 39-year-old defender made 39 appearances for the club across all competitions last season, contributing five assists from his right-back position. Trimmel has significant experience with 194 Bundesliga appearances to his name.
Entering his 13th season with die Eisernen, Trimmel has made a total of 391 competitive appearances for the team. The Austrian international, who has earned 25 caps, could become the club’s all-time appearance leader this season. Alongside Trimmel, midfielder Rani Khedira and goalkeeper Frederik Rønnow form the club’s leadership council. This year, they may also be joined by rising Germany U21 international Aljoscha Kemlein.

Lustrinelli’s words on Christopher Trimmel
“There’s no question about the captaincy,” Lustrinelli stated to the tabloid. “Christopher Trimmel will, of course, remain the captain.“
“[Prior to the start of training camp], the coach let me know how important I am,” Trimmel responded. “That naturally makes me very happy. If I’m needed, I’m there.“
